Chief CPU Software Architect

2 days ago


Salem, Tamil Nadu, India beBeeCPU Full time ₹ 1,50,00,000 - ₹ 2,00,00,000
Job Description

Seeking a highly skilled Core CPU Architect to drive innovations in core CPU, firmware/OS enablement, and performance tuning for next-generation SoCs used in automotive and edge computing platforms.

The ideal candidate will work at the intersection of CPU design and system software, collaborating with CPU design and silicon teams on pipeline features, caches, coherency protocols, branch prediction, and power states.

  • Key Responsibilities:
  • Define and architect core CPU software interfaces (firmware, BSP, drivers) aligned with ARM CPU microarchitecture features.
  • Design and implement low-level firmware and kernel components for CPU initialization, exception handling, MMU setup, coherency, and memory management.
  • Collaborate with CPU design and silicon teams on pipeline features, caches, coherency protocols, branch prediction, and power states.
  • Lead Linux kernel and RTOS integration for CPU subsystems, focusing on scheduling, memory, and power-aware optimizations.
  • Drive CPU power management strategies: clock gating, DVFS, retention states, idle states, and adaptive scaling.
  • Perform CPU and memory subsystem performance profiling using simulators, emulators, JTAG, and hardware trace/debug tools.
  • Define system-level performance/power KPIs and lead tuning across CPU, firmware, kernel, and device drivers.
  • Mentor engineers and guide architecture reviews, patents, and long-term CPU strategy.
  • Partner with cross-functional teams to deliver high-performance CPU platforms.
Required Skills & Qualifications
  • CPU Architecture: Deep expertise in ARMv8/v9 architecture, exception levels, MMU, caches, coherency protocols, ISA extensions, and PMU.
  • Firmware & Kernel: Strong hands-on experience in firmware, Linux kernel internals, RTOS, and device drivers.
  • Performance & Power: Proven ability in CPU pipeline analysis, memory subsystem tuning, DVFS, cpuidle/cpufreq frameworks, and power-performance tradeoff analysis.
  • Debug & Bring-up: Experience in CPU bring-up, silicon validation, trace analyzers, emulators, JTAG, and kernel tracing tools.
  • Programming: Proficiency in C/C++ and assembly (ARM), with Python/Shell for automation.
  • I/O & Interconnects: Familiarity with PCIe, Ethernet, I²C, SPI, CAN, USB, and memory buses (DDR, LPDDR).
  • Problem Solving: Strong ability to root-cause complex issues across CPU architecture, firmware, and OS layers.
Preferred Qualifications
  • Contributions to open-source CPU enablement (Linux kernel, toolchains, firmware frameworks).
  • Background in automotive, mobile SoCs, or Edge computing platforms with strict latency and performance KPIs.
  • Technical leadership in CPU/SoC co-design projects involving hardware, firmware, and OS integration.


  • Salem, Tamil Nadu, India beBeeSoftwareEngineering Full time ₹ 1,50,00,000 - ₹ 2,50,00,000

    Job Title:Chief Software Engineering Officer">We empower professionals to achieve more in their careers. Our innovative products and technology make a direct impact on the workforce.">We seek a passionate and entrepreneurial engineering leader to join our team. In this role, you will lead engineers in developing new products and services, and scaling...


  • Salem, Tamil Nadu, India beBeeExpert Full time ₹ 1,50,00,000 - ₹ 2,00,00,000

    Job Title: Embedded Software Modeling ExpertMirafra Technologies is a renowned technology design product engineering services company with expertise in semiconductor design and embedded software development. Founded in 2004, the company has established a strong track record of delivering projects to clients across various domains worldwide. Our customer base...


  • Salem, Tamil Nadu, India beBeeData Full time ₹ 1,50,00,000 - ₹ 2,50,00,000

    Software Engineer - Data ArchitectWe are seeking a skilled professional to design and implement data solutions in Azure.Key Responsibilities:Develop ETL/ELT pipelines using Azure Data Factory (ADF), Databricks, and Synapse Analytics.Design scalable data architectures following best practices.Perform data ingestion, transformation, and orchestration across...


  • Salem, Tamil Nadu, India beBeeBackendEngineering Full time ₹ 8,00,000 - ₹ 15,00,000

    Job Overview:The position of Software Solutions Architect is responsible for designing and implementing complex systems using Python.Develop and deploy machine learning models as APIs utilizing Python frameworks.Create a consumption layer on top of a database layer to provide efficient data access.


  • Salem, Tamil Nadu, India beBeeSoftware Full time ₹ 1,50,00,000 - ₹ 2,00,00,000

    Senior Lead Engineer PositionWe are seeking a highly skilled software architect to join our team.Job Description:The successful candidate will be responsible for designing, developing, and implementing high-quality software solutions that meet the needs of our clients. This includes working closely with cross-functional teams to identify project...


  • Salem, Tamil Nadu, India beBeeFrontend Full time ₹ 10,00,000 - ₹ 15,00,000

    Senior Frontend DeveloperThis role involves leading the frontend development of high-performance web applications. As a senior front-end developer, you will be responsible for architecting and implementing scalable, efficient, and reliable frontend solutions.Key Responsibilities:Design and implement robust frontend architecturesLead technical initiatives to...


  • Salem, Tamil Nadu, India beBeeSoftware Full time ₹ 15,00,000 - ₹ 21,00,000

    We're looking for a Senior Software Architect to lead our Customer Experience Engineering team. This is a critical role that requires technical leadership and vision to build scalable, maintainable systems for customer billing, contracting, and enterprise account management.Key ResponsibilitiesBilling EngineDesign, develop, and maintain the billing engine...


  • Salem, Tamil Nadu, India beBeeData Full time ₹ 1,84,58,265 - ₹ 3,01,23,521

    Enterprise Data Architect RoleReady to take on a challenging role where you can drive business outcomes through innovative data solutions?Job Description:We are seeking an experienced Enterprise Data Architect to oversee the management of client business data assets in alignment with our Data & Analytics Strategy.The successful candidate will be responsible...

  • Chief Architect

    2 days ago


    Salem, Tamil Nadu, India beBeePython Full time ₹ 20,00,000 - ₹ 25,00,000

    Job Title: Technical LeadAs a seasoned Technical Lead, you will oversee the development and integration of Python-based applications with large language models (LLMs). Your key responsibility will be to architect and implement LLM pipelines, including prompt engineering, retrieval-augmented generation (RAG), fine-tuning, and evaluation.Required Skills:Strong...


  • Salem, Tamil Nadu, India beBeeArchitecturalDrafting Full time ₹ 10,000 - ₹ 12,000

    Job Summary:A full-time Architectural Draftsman is required to create detailed technical drawings and plans using computer-aided design (CAD) software. Collaborate with architects and engineers to develop and modify designs, ensuring compliance with industry standards.Key Responsibilities:Utilize CAD software such as AutoCAD to create detailed technical...